Abstract

fetched live from OpenAlex

This paper provides a non-technical introduction to monetary policy — what it is, how it works, and why it matters. It discusses inflation volatility and why this is damaging to the economy, as well as why increased stability of output growth is desirable. In both cases changes in Canadian economic performance over the past few decades are examined. The paper also provides a detailed discussion of the monetary transmission mechanism, and the types of uncertainty that central banks must face in their conduct of monetary policy. Finally, the paper describes the types of information that central banks need in order to conduct monetary policy prudently.
